Subject: Re: [PATCH] mwl8k: use integral index instead of pointer for driver_data

On Friday 06 November 2009 22:56:59 Michael Buesch wrote:
> On Friday 06 November 2009 22:42:07 John W. Linville wrote:
> > @@ -3379,7 +3378,7 @@ static int __devinit mwl8k_probe(struct pci_dev *pdev,
> >  	priv = hw->priv;
> >  	priv->hw = hw;
> >  	priv->pdev = pdev;
> > -	priv->device_info = (void *)id->driver_data;
> > +	priv->device_info = &mwl8k_info_tbl[id->driver_data];
> >  	priv->rxd_ops = priv->device_info->rxd_ops;
> >  	priv->sniffer_enabled = false;
> >  	priv->wmm_enabled = false;
> 
> What about a sanity check for id->driver_data on the array range? Otherwise one could crash
> the kernel with sysfs/new_id by accident, as far as I can tell.
> 

Ok docs say that:
> Note that driver_data must match the value used by any of the pci_device_id
> entries defined in the driver. 

So ignore me.
